Handover notes on encoding detection for the Drayfield upload service: the detector now falls back to UTF-8 with replacement instead of rejecting files, per last week's incident. Latin-1 heuristics live in charset_guess.py; the confidence threshold is 0.6. Windows-1252 smart quotes remain the main false-positive source. Open questions and test fixtures go to the ingestion maintainers list.

pager mailbox: druwyn@norvaio.corp

MEMO — Shift to Annual Billing

Hi all — quick heads-up from the revenue side. Starting next quarter, new Quillbase customers will default to annual billing, with monthly plans kept only for legacy accounts. Finance needs to update invoicing templates, proration logic, and the deferred revenue schedule before the switch. Petra's team will circulate draft journal entries for review. Expect some noisy churn numbers for a cycle or two while the cohorts settle. The reasoning behind the timing is set out below.

confidential, kagup-bafog: Fraaxax Group is in early talks to buy Soroxox Group for about $343.8 million. The Olidor launch date is June 14, and nothing goes to the press before then. Legal wants the Aldmirek Logistics term sheet signed before July 23.

Context for the sync: the Gradewick solver's service account locks when constraint runs exceed the nightly window and auth tokens expire mid-solve. Symptoms: stalled timetable jobs for Ellsmere Academy tenants, solver queue backing up. Recovery: pause the scheduler, clear half-finished solve state, restore the account from the recovery console, then rerun the smallest tenant first to confirm feasible timetables. Do not bulk-retry; it thrashes the solver. To restore the service account, enter the recovery passphrase below.

recovery phrase for fajep-yaweg: gilath-sorox-wenius-rusdor-keliel-zorius